X-Git-Url: http://matita.cs.unibo.it/gitweb/?a=blobdiff_plain;f=matita%2Fmatita%2Fcontribs%2Flambdadelta%2Fdelayed_updating%2Freduction%2Fibfr_lift.ma;h=1b6bb9903a4ce30e9f758b585ed7de5deb550a3e;hb=d108bcea8ebae11b03e8d8a155dfd3f2eb445127;hp=ac690a3bc6a8a76cc49fda6149e4541c26e479fe;hpb=4939d8280cb3467cd8fa648b1cea04f74d71e8b7;p=helm.git diff --git a/matita/matita/contribs/lambdadelta/delayed_updating/reduction/ibfr_lift.ma b/matita/matita/contribs/lambdadelta/delayed_updating/reduction/ibfr_lift.ma index ac690a3bc..1b6bb9903 100644 --- a/matita/matita/contribs/lambdadelta/delayed_updating/reduction/ibfr_lift.ma +++ b/matita/matita/contribs/lambdadelta/delayed_updating/reduction/ibfr_lift.ma @@ -19,6 +19,7 @@ include "delayed_updating/substitution/fsubst_eq.ma". include "delayed_updating/substitution/lift_prototerm_after.ma". include "delayed_updating/substitution/lift_path_structure.ma". include "delayed_updating/substitution/lift_path_closed.ma". +include "delayed_updating/substitution/lift_path_guard.ma". include "delayed_updating/substitution/lift_rmap_closed.ma". include "ground/relocation/tr_uni_compose.ma". @@ -31,17 +32,19 @@ include "ground/relocation/tr_compose_eq.ma". theorem ibfr_lift_bi (f) (t1) (t2) (r): t1 ➡𝐢𝐛𝐟[r] t2 → 🠡[f]t1 ➡𝐢𝐛𝐟[🠡[f]r] 🠡[f]t2. #f #t1 #t2 #r -* #p #b #q #m #n #Hr #Hb #Hm #Hn #Ht1 #Ht2 destruct -@(ex6_5_intro … (🠡[f]p) (🠡[🠢[f](p◖𝗔)]b) (🠡[🠢[f](p◖𝗔●b◖𝗟)]q) (🠢[f](p●𝗔◗b)@❨m❩) (🠢[f](p●𝗔◗b●𝗟◗q)@§❨n❩)) -[ -Hb -Hm -Hn -Ht1 -Ht2 // -| -Hm -Hn -Ht1 -Ht2 // -| -Hb -Hn -Ht1 -Ht2 +* #p #b #q #m #n #Hr #Hp #Hb #Hm #Hn #Ht1 #Ht2 destruct +@(ex7_5_intro … (🠡[f]p) (🠡[🠢[f](p◖𝗔)]b) (🠡[🠢[f](p◖𝗔●b◖𝗟)]q) (🠢[f](p●𝗔◗b)@❨m❩) (🠢[f](p●𝗔◗b●𝗟◗q)@§❨n❩)) +[ -Hp -Hb -Hm -Hn -Ht1 -Ht2 // +| -Hb -Hm -Hn -Ht1 -Ht2 + /2 width=1 by lift_path_guard/ +| -Hp -Hm -Hn -Ht1 -Ht2 // +| -Hp -Hb -Hn -Ht1 -Ht2 /2 width=1 by lift_path_closed/ -| -Hb -Hm -Ht1 -Ht2 +| -Hp -Hb -Hm -Ht1 -Ht2 /2 width=1 by lift_path_rmap_closed_L/ -| lapply (in_comp_lift_path_term f … Ht1) -Ht2 -Ht1 -Hn +| lapply (in_comp_lift_path_term f … Ht1) -Ht2 -Ht1 -Hp -Hn